About this role
BBS Recruitment is an independent recruitment agency for transport and logistics sector, supplying to a variety of clients across UK.
We are recruiting a Ground Maintenance Operative for our client based in Croydon.
The purpose of the role is to provide a high-quality estate services and property maintenance service, ensuring communal areas, external environments, and residential properties are clean, safe, attractive, and well maintained. The postholder will undertake cleaning, gardening, and minor maintenance tasks while delivering excellent customer service to residents and supporting the wider Estate Services team.
Responsibilities for the
Ground Maintenance Operative
• Maintain high standards of cleanliness throughout communal areas, including entrances, corridors, stairwells, lifts, walkways, laundry rooms, and other shared facilities.
• Carry out routine cleaning duties including sweeping, mopping, vacuuming, dusting, polishing, litter picking, sanitising touch points, and removing cobwebs.
• Clean, disinfect, and maintain refuse chutes, bin stores, recycling areas, and external waste disposal facilities to ensure they remain hygienic and presentable.
• Operate cleaning equipment and machinery such as jet washers, steam cleaners, floor cleaning machines, and other specialist equipment following appropriate training.
• Undertake gardening and grounds maintenance duties to ensure estates remain tidy, safe, and visually appealing.
• Carry out grass cutting, hedge trimming, pruning shrubs, weeding flower beds, watering plants, leaf clearance, sweeping pathways, and maintaining landscaped areas.
• Plant seasonal flowers, shrubs, and bedding plants where required and assist in maintaining green spaces and communal gardens.
• Remove garden waste, litter, fly tipping, and other environmental hazards from external areas.
• Carry out minor repairs and maintenance of a basic semi-skilled nature within communal areas and residents' homes as instructed.
• Undertake basic joinery, plumbing repairs (such as unblocking sinks and toilets), internal decorating, lock changes, graffiti removal, and minor fabric repairs.
• Inspect communal areas and estate facilities, identifying maintenance issues and reporting defects promptly to the relevant maintenance teams.
• Carry out routine inspections, health and safety checks, and complete accurate records and reports as required.
• Ensure all tools, equipment, vehicles, machinery, and materials are used safely, maintained correctly, and stored securely after use.
• Respond promptly to emergency maintenance issues where appropriate and assist in making safe any hazards identified.
• Provide flexible cover across estates and support colleagues during periods of absence or increased workload.
• Act as a professional first point of contact for residents, contractors, and visitors by providing advice, assistance, or referring enquiries to the appropriate department
• Build positive relationships with residents and remain aware of vulnerable individuals, escalating concerns to the Housing Team or line manager where appropriate.
• Work collaboratively with housing officers, contractors, cleaners, gardeners, and maintenance teams to deliver excellent estate management services.
• Ensure compliance with Health and Safety legislation, COSHH regulations, risk assessments, and safe systems of work.
• Wear and correctly use all Personal Protective Equipment (PPE) provided and take responsibility for maintaining a safe working environment.
